refactor(phase0): source-agnostic formatter/gating scaffold + harness (inert) (#28)
Foundation for making all hazard formatting+gating source-agnostic. ZERO
behavior change — the formatter/decider registries are empty (get_formatter/
get_decider return None → existing precomposed/Mode-B path preserved), and the
shadow comparator is off unless MESHAI_SHADOW_CATEGORIES is set.

- notifications/formatters/ (registry+dispatch with family fallback), gating/
  (GateResult + deferred-commit contract), both empty registries.
- notifications/clock.py determinism seam; route wfigs/quake/nws gating time
  reads through it (identical values) so goldens can freeze time.
- formatters/_budget.py = copy of central/budget.py; central/budget.py is now a
  re-export shim (import-smoke test guards it).
- compose_mesh_message consults the registry first (verbatim, no Mode-B re-cap),
  falls back to legacy; _resolve_budget injects per-category budget.
- notifications/shadow.py + two DRY-RUN hooks (consumer._normalize, dispatcher
  render): compute the new result and diff-log SHADOW_MISMATCH JSONL, but NEVER
  commit/emit/write tables and always broadcast the OLD result. Inert by default.
- tests/harness (pinned_time/pinned_tz, byte-golden, gate-sequence) +
  scripts/capture_fixtures.py (ephemeral read-only NATS capture); tzdata pinned.

Tests: +60 (18 scaffold + 42 harness/shadow); 0 new failures (34 baseline).

"""Phase-0b: verify shadow hooks are inert by default and never mutate state.
Test cases:
1. MESHAI_SHADOW_CATEGORIES unset → shadow_gate / shadow_render are pure no-ops
(no filesystem, no DB, no exception).
2. MESHAI_SHADOW_CATEGORIES set to a category with no decider registered →
still no-op (get_decider returns None, early return).
3. MESHAI_SHADOW_CATEGORIES set to a category with no formatter registered →
still no-op (get_formatter returns None, early return).
4. shadow_gate / shadow_render never raise regardless of input.
"""
from __future__ import annotations
import os
import pytest
import meshai.notifications.shadow as shadow_mod
def _reset_shadow_cache():
"""Clear lru_cache so env-var changes take effect."""
shadow_mod._clear_enabled_cache()
# ---------------------------------------------------------------------------
# Helper: a minimal fake Event-like object for shadow_render
# ---------------------------------------------------------------------------
class _FakeEvent:
id = "test-event-001"
category = "earthquake_event"
source = "usgs_quake"
data: dict = {}
# ---------------------------------------------------------------------------
# Case 1: env var unset — must be completely off
# ---------------------------------------------------------------------------
class TestShadowInertWhenEnvUnset:
"""With MESHAI_SHADOW_CATEGORIES unset, all shadow functions are no-ops."""
def setup_method(self):
os.environ.pop("MESHAI_SHADOW_CATEGORIES", None)
_reset_shadow_cache()
def test_enabled_for_returns_false(self):
assert shadow_mod.enabled_for("earthquake_event") is False
assert shadow_mod.enabled_for("nws") is False
assert shadow_mod.enabled_for("") is False
def test_shadow_gate_no_filesystem(self, tmp_path, monkeypatch):
"""shadow_gate must not touch the filesystem when the env var is unset."""
monkeypatch.setattr(shadow_mod, "_SHADOW_DIR", str(tmp_path / "shadow"))
shadow_mod.shadow_gate(
"earthquake_event",
{"_severity_override": "immediate"},
source="usgs_quake",
now=1_700_000_000.0,
old_broadcast=True,
)
# No shadow dir should have been created.
assert not (tmp_path / "shadow").exists()
def test_shadow_render_no_filesystem(self, tmp_path, monkeypatch):
"""shadow_render must not touch the filesystem when the env var is unset."""
monkeypatch.setattr(shadow_mod, "_SHADOW_DIR", str(tmp_path / "shadow"))
shadow_mod.shadow_render(
"earthquake_event",
_FakeEvent(),
old_wire="🌍 EQ M4.2: Test, ID 30mi NE routine",
)
assert not (tmp_path / "shadow").exists()
def test_shadow_gate_returns_none(self):
result = shadow_mod.shadow_gate(
"earthquake_event", {}, source="usgs", now=0.0, old_broadcast=False
)
assert result is None
def test_shadow_render_returns_none(self):
result = shadow_mod.shadow_render(
"earthquake_event", _FakeEvent(), old_wire="something"
)
assert result is None
# ---------------------------------------------------------------------------
# Case 2: env var set but no decider registered for that category
# ---------------------------------------------------------------------------
class TestShadowInertWhenNoDecider:
"""MESHAI_SHADOW_CATEGORIES set but DECIDERS empty → still no-op."""
def setup_method(self):
os.environ["MESHAI_SHADOW_CATEGORIES"] = "earthquake_event"
_reset_shadow_cache()
def teardown_method(self):
os.environ.pop("MESHAI_SHADOW_CATEGORIES", None)
_reset_shadow_cache()
def test_enabled_for_returns_true(self):
assert shadow_mod.enabled_for("earthquake_event") is True
def test_shadow_gate_no_filesystem_when_no_decider(self, tmp_path, monkeypatch):
"""get_decider returns None → shadow_gate exits before any file write."""
monkeypatch.setattr(shadow_mod, "_SHADOW_DIR", str(tmp_path / "shadow"))
# DECIDERS is empty (Phase 0 scaffold), so get_decider("earthquake_event")
# returns None and shadow_gate returns early without writing anything.
shadow_mod.shadow_gate(
"earthquake_event",
{"_dedup_suffix": "M4.2"},
source="usgs_quake",
now=1_700_000_000.0,
old_broadcast=True,
)
assert not (tmp_path / "shadow").exists()
def test_shadow_gate_does_not_raise(self):
"""shadow_gate must not propagate any exception."""
try:
shadow_mod.shadow_gate(
"earthquake_event",
None, # intentionally bad input — must not raise
source="usgs_quake",
now=1_700_000_000.0,
old_broadcast=False,
)
except Exception as exc:
pytest.fail(f"shadow_gate raised unexpectedly: {exc!r}")
# ---------------------------------------------------------------------------
# Case 3: env var set but no formatter registered for that category
# ---------------------------------------------------------------------------
class TestShadowRenderInertWhenNoFormatter:
"""MESHAI_SHADOW_CATEGORIES set but FORMATTERS empty → still no-op."""
def setup_method(self):
os.environ["MESHAI_SHADOW_CATEGORIES"] = "earthquake_event"
_reset_shadow_cache()
def teardown_method(self):
os.environ.pop("MESHAI_SHADOW_CATEGORIES", None)
_reset_shadow_cache()
def test_shadow_render_no_filesystem_when_no_formatter(self, tmp_path, monkeypatch):
"""get_formatter returns None → shadow_render exits before any file write."""
monkeypatch.setattr(shadow_mod, "_SHADOW_DIR", str(tmp_path / "shadow"))
shadow_mod.shadow_render(
"earthquake_event",
_FakeEvent(),
old_wire="old wire string",
)
assert not (tmp_path / "shadow").exists()
def test_shadow_render_does_not_raise(self):
"""shadow_render must not propagate any exception."""
try:
shadow_mod.shadow_render(
"earthquake_event",
None, # intentionally bad input — must not raise
old_wire="anything",
)
except Exception as exc:
pytest.fail(f"shadow_render raised unexpectedly: {exc!r}")
# ---------------------------------------------------------------------------
# Case 4: multiple categories, partial enable
# ---------------------------------------------------------------------------
class TestShadowPartialEnable:
"""Only listed categories are enabled; others stay off."""
def setup_method(self):
os.environ["MESHAI_SHADOW_CATEGORIES"] = "nws,earthquake_event"
_reset_shadow_cache()
def teardown_method(self):
os.environ.pop("MESHAI_SHADOW_CATEGORIES", None)
_reset_shadow_cache()
def test_listed_category_is_enabled(self):
assert shadow_mod.enabled_for("nws") is True
assert shadow_mod.enabled_for("earthquake_event") is True
def test_unlisted_category_is_disabled(self):
assert shadow_mod.enabled_for("fire") is False
assert shadow_mod.enabled_for("geomagnetic_storm") is False
def test_shadow_gate_off_for_unlisted(self, tmp_path, monkeypatch):
monkeypatch.setattr(shadow_mod, "_SHADOW_DIR", str(tmp_path / "shadow"))
shadow_mod.shadow_gate(
"fire", {}, source="wfigs", now=0.0, old_broadcast=True
)
assert not (tmp_path / "shadow").exists()
